The AMD company and brand has been around for a number of years.  Even though most people don't consider the fact that this particular company manufactures things other than the CPU, they do have quite a history of producing different components that go into the computer.  Even before the PC was a normal thing and computers were mainly made for large businesses and server operations, AMD was producing components that helped these computers to run.  It wasn't until the 1980s that they actually landed a contract with Intel, even though this contract was short lived.  Shortly thereafter, AMD produced their own brand of processor and quickly became a competitor for Intel itself.

The AMD Athlon XP CPU is just one in a very long line of processors that the AMD Corp. has manufactured.  Some of these CPUs that are still in existence are based on this particular model.  In fact, the AMD Athlon XP CPU is being manufactured for many computers today.  It is difficult to list all of the different Athlon XP processors that were ever manufactured but some of the newer ones are capable of handling any of the multitasking or computer programs that you would run on your PC.  Not only is it a high speed choice, it is economical as well and can help you to afford a PC without having to pay a bloated price for another, competing CPU.

If you are going to choose an AMD Athlon XP CPU for your computer, you are going to have to make sure that you have compatible components available.  This particular CPU will not work on every motherboard out there so you should check out the AMD website to find out any compatibility issues that may exist.  You're also going to need to consider the fact that this particular CPU is going to need cooled  so that you do not burn it out quickly.  This can be done by the use of a CPU fan.

In older computers, it was easy to be able to keep the processor cool by the use of a heatsink but in the newer computers a little more is necessary than that.  This is because, as processors get stronger day continue to use additional power and put off additional heat.  Because of this heat, it is an easy thing for you to burn out your processor within a few minutes if you do not have it cooled correctly.  You may also be compromising the ability of your computer to run smoothly as a result of this heat.
